Robotic Bartender Sales Market Outlook
The global Robotic Bartender Sales Market is projected to reach USD 1.8 billion by 2035, growing at a CAGR of approximately 15.8%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2035. This growth can be attributed to the rising demand for automation in the hospitality industry, which is increasingly seeking innovative solutions to enhance customer experience and streamline operations. The trend of incorporating technology into everyday tasks has led to a surge in the adoption of robotic bartenders, particularly in bars, restaurants, hotels, and at private events. The convenience of these systems, along with their ability to deliver consistent quality and unique experiences, is driving their popularity. Moreover, the ongoing advancements in artificial intelligence and robotics are facilitating product innovation, which is further propelling the market growth.

By Product Type
Fully Automated Robotic Bartenders:
Fully automated robotic bartenders are designed to handle the entire bartending process without human intervention. These systems are equipped with advanced technology that enables them to mix, serve, and customize drinks based on customer preferences. Their efficiency and ability to operate continuously without fatigue make them a popular choice in high-volume venues such as bars and nightclubs. The integration of artificial intelligence allows these robotic bartenders to learn from customer interactions and improve their service over time. This type of robotic bartender significantly reduces wait times and enhances customer satisfaction, making it a preferred option for establishments looking to optimize their service. Additionally, their ability to produce drinks with consistent taste and presentation is a major selling point for businesses aiming to maintain brand image and quality.
Semi-Automated Robotic Bartenders:
Semi-automated robotic bartenders offer a middle ground between fully automated systems and traditional bartending. These units require some level of human involvement, such as selecting the drink ingredients or initiating the mixing process. They are particularly appealing for establishments that want to incorporate technology without completely replacing human interaction. Semi-automated bartenders are often used in settings where a personal touch is still valued, allowing bartenders to engage with customers while benefiting from the efficiency and accuracy of robotic assistance. This category of robotic bartenders is gaining traction in niche markets and smaller establishments, where cost-effectiveness and versatility are essential. Their flexibility in operation makes them suitable for a broader range of environments, from upscale restaurants to casual bars.
DIY Robotic Bartender Kits:
DIY robotic bartender kits cater to a growing segment of consumers interested in technology and home entertainment. These kits allow individuals to build and customize their own robotic bartenders, appealing to hobbyists and tech enthusiasts. The availability of various components and the ease of assembly make these kits accessible to a wide audience. These products often come with instructional manuals and software that facilitate the setup process, enabling users to create a personalized bartending experience at home. The DIY aspect not only enhances user engagement but also fosters creativity as individuals can experiment with different drink recipes and configurations. As home entertainment continues to gain popularity, particularly in the post-pandemic era, the demand for DIY robotic bartender kits is expected to rise significantly.

By Technology
Artificial Intelligence:
Artificial intelligence (AI) is a cornerstone technology in the development of robotic bartenders, enabling them to learn and adapt to customer preferences over time. AI algorithms allow these systems to analyze user interactions and feedback, leading to improved service efficiency and personalization. For instance, AI-driven bartenders can recommend drinks based on previous orders or suggest new cocktails based on popular trends. Additionally, AI enhances the operational capabilities of robotic bartenders, enabling them to manage inventory, track ingredient usage, and optimize drink preparation processes. The incorporation of AI technology is not only improving the user experience but also driving better business outcomes for establishments utilizing robotic bartenders.
Internet of Things:
The Internet of Things (IoT) technology allows robotic bartenders to connect to various devices and systems, creating a seamless and integrated service experience. This connectivity facilitates real-time monitoring and data sharing, enabling robotic bartenders to communicate with inventory management systems and point-of-sale solutions. As a result, establishments can better manage their operations by receiving alerts for low stock levels or integrating payment processing. IoT technology also paves the way for remote management, allowing operators to oversee multiple robotic bartenders across different locations from a single device. The ability to gather data on customer preferences and operational efficiency through IoT connectivity enhances decision-making processes and improves overall service delivery.
Voice Recognition:
Voice recognition technology is becoming increasingly prevalent in robotic bartenders, enabling customers to interact with these systems using simple voice commands. This feature enhances user-friendliness and provides a hands-free option for ordering drinks, which is particularly appealing in busy environments. Voice-activated robotic bartenders can respond to customer requests, provide information about drink options, and even suggest pairings based on dietary preferences. The integration of voice recognition technology not only elevates the customer experience but also streamlines service processes, allowing for quicker response times and reducing the workload on human staff. As consumers become more accustomed to voice-activated technology, the demand for robotic bartenders equipped with this functionality is expected to grow.
Robotic Arm:
The robotic arm is a critical component of robotic bartenders, responsible for performing the physical tasks of mixing, pouring, and serving drinks. These arms are designed with precision and dexterity, allowing them to handle various glassware and ingredients with care. The advanced mechanics of robotic arms enable them to replicate complex bartending techniques, such as shaking cocktails and garnishing drinks, ensuring that the final product meets high standards. Additionally, the design of robotic arms can vary based on the intended application, with some units featuring multiple arms for enhanced productivity. As technology advances, the capabilities and efficiency of robotic arms are expected to improve, further solidifying their importance in the robotic bartender market.
Others:
This category includes various supporting technologies that contribute to the functionality of robotic bartenders. These may encompass sensor technologies that detect customer presence and preferences, advanced mixing technologies that ensure consistency in drink preparation, and software solutions that manage the overall user interface. Each of these components plays a crucial role in enhancing the operational capabilities of robotic bartenders, allowing them to deliver a seamless and enjoyable experience for users. As the market continues to evolve, ongoing innovations in supporting technologies are likely to drive further advancements in the functionality and appeal of robotic bartenders.

Threats
Despite the promising growth prospects, the Robotic Bartender Sales Market faces several threats that could hinder its expansion. One of the primary challenges is the high initial investment required for businesses to implement robotic bartender systems. Many smaller establishments may be hesitant to transition due to the upfront costs, which can limit the market's potential growth. Additionally, the rapid pace of technological advancements means that businesses must continually invest in upgrades and maintenance to remain competitive. Failure to keep up with innovations could result in businesses falling behind in customer engagement and service efficiency. Furthermore, concerns related to customer acceptance of robotic bartenders pose a threat, as some consumers may prefer the personal touch of human bartenders. This potential resistance can impact the rate of adoption among businesses, particularly in markets that prioritize traditional hospitality services.
Moreover, competition from established bartending service providers and traditional establishments presents a continuous challenge to the robotic bartender market. As more companies enter the market and offer innovative solutions, price competition may arise, further complicating the landscape for manufacturers. Additionally, regulatory challenges related to food and beverage service automation can pose barriers to market entry and expansion. Compliance with health and safety regulations, as well as labor laws, can create hurdles for businesses looking to incorporate robotic bartenders into their operations. Maintaining a balance between technological innovation and adherence to regulatory requirements will be essential for market players to navigate these threats successfully.

Among the key players in the market, Makr Shakr stands out as a pioneer in robotic bartending, known for its cutting-edge technology and innovative designs. The company has successfully integrated AI and IoT capabilities into its robotic bartenders, enabling them to deliver personalized drink experiences. Makr Shakr has partnered with numerous restaurants and bars globally, expanding its reach and establishing itself as a leader in the industry. Similarly, Bartesian has gained recognition for its home-use robotic bartender system, which allows users to create cocktails easily by using pod-based technology. This innovative approach has attracted attention from consumers looking for convenient and high-quality home entertainment solutions.
Additionally, RoboBar and BarMixvah are notable competitors, each offering unique solutions tailored to specific market segments. RoboBar focuses on providing fully automated systems suitable for commercial settings, while BarMixvah specializes in providing robotic bartenders for events and private parties, showcasing the versatility of robotics in various applications.
